Michigan abortion ban vetoed, new bill on deck
By Chris Jackett
STAFF WRITER

Despite successfully passing through both the Republican-controlled Senate and Democrat-controlled House, Gov. Jennifer Granholm (D-Lansing) vetoed a bill banning partial-birth abortion last Friday.

"I think the governor's veto was extremely unrealistic and economical with the truth," said Sen. Nancy Cassis (R-Novi), who co-sponsored the bill. "The title of this is to stop the killing of the children who are partially born. I don't think there are any more horrendous acts of murder than this being done. I don't believe in killing children when that child is fully formed and ready to be alive. It's murder, pure and simple. It's murder. The governor has gone along with contributing to the murder of children. This would have safeguarded the life of the mother and life of the child."

Senate Bill 776 was approved 24-13 Jan. 22 by Senate leaders and 74-32 May 27 by the House before it was vetoed June 13.

"I will not support a late-term abortion ban that fails to protect both the life and health of mothers," Granholm said in a statement to Senate leaders. "Medical professionals oppose this legislation because it does not contain valid exception for the health of the mother. They believe that medical decisions of this nature should be made by women and their doctors, not politicians. I agree."

From Bill No. 776:
4) It is not a violation of subsection (3) if in the physician's reasonable medical judgment a partial-birth abortion is necessary to save the life of a mother whose life is endangered by a physical disorder, physical illness, or physical injury.
